Leaky Roof Replacement in Providence, RI
Leaky roof replacement services involve removing damaged or aging roofing materials and installing new, durable roofing systems to protect a property from water intrusion and structural damage. This service typically covers residential roofs of various styles and materials, including asphalt shingles, metal roofing, and other common options. Homeowners often seek roof replacement when leaks persist despite repairs, or when the existing roof has reached the end of its lifespan, showing signs such as curling, missing shingles, or extensive wear.
Before requesting a roof replacement,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the condition of the underlying roof structure and whether any additional repairs are necessary. It’s also important to consider factors like the type of roofing material, the expected lifespan of the new roof, and any local building codes or regulations that may influence the project. Clear information about these aspects can help homeowners make informed decisions about their roof replacement needs.

Signs Of A Leaky Roof
Water stains, mold, and peeling paint can indicate roof leaks that need attention.
Benefits Of Roof Replacement
Replacing a damaged roof helps protect the home and prevents further structural issues.
Common Causes Of Leaks
Roof leaks often result from damaged shingles, flashing failure, or aging roofing materials.

Leaky Roof Replacement Questions
What causes a roof to leak? Leaks can result from damaged shingles, deteriorated flashing, or accumulated debris that allows water to seep inside.
How can I tell if my roof is leaking? Signs include water stains on ceilings or walls, mold growth, or visible drips during rain.
What are common signs of roof damage? Missing or curling shingles, cracked flashing, and sagging roof areas are typical indicators of potential leaks.
Why should I consider roof replacement for a leaky roof? Replacing the roof ensures the integrity of the structure and prevents further water damage to the property.
